Self-Exclusion Programs
One of the most powerful tools for controlling gambling habits is self-exclusion programs. These programs allow individuals to voluntarily exclude themselves from a particular casino or gambling site for a set period of time. By removing the temptation to gamble, self-exclusion programs can help individuals break the cycle of compulsive gambling and regain control over their behavior.
Many casinos and online gambling sites offer self-exclusion programs, and some even provide additional support services such as counseling and referrals to treatment programs. Time and Money Management Tools
Another important aspect of controlling gambling habits is effective time and money management. By setting limits on how much time and money you can spend on gambling, you can help prevent impulsive behavior and maintain a healthy balance in your life.
There are a variety of tools and resources available to help you manage your time and money more effectively. For example, many online gambling sites offer features that allow you to set limits on your deposits, losses, and time spent playing. Additionally, there are apps and websites that can help you track your gambling activity and provide insights into your spending habits.
Counseling and Support Groups
If you are struggling to control your gambling habits, seeking professional help may be beneficial. Counseling and support groups can provide you with the tools and strategies you need to overcome your addiction and make positive changes in your life.
There are many resources available for individuals struggling with gambling addiction, including individual counseling, group therapy, and support groups such as Gamblers Anonymous. These resources can provide you with the guidance and support you need to overcome your addiction and build a healthier relationship with gambling.
